What Are Cataracts and also How Do They Develop?



Cataracts are a typical eye condition that generally develops gradually gradually. They happen when the healthy proteins in the lens of your eye beginning to clump together, triggering the lens to end up being over cast. This cloudiness can make it tough to see clearly and also can also lead to vision loss if left without treatment.

While age is a significant danger aspect for establishing cataracts, various other variables such as genes, cigarette smoking, and also particular clinical problems can likewise raise your opportunities.

Comprehending exactly how cataracts develop is the initial step in comprehending why cataract eye surgical procedure might be needed.

Sorts Of Cataract Surgical Procedure



Sorts of cataract surgery can vary depending on the intensity of the problem and also individual requirements. One of the most common kind is phacoemulsification, which uses ultrasound energy to separate the cloudy lens and also remove it via a small laceration.

Extracapsular cataract extraction is an additional option, entailing a larger laceration to eliminate the cloudy lens intact.
